Believe your prayer is answered, truly so.
For God in wisdom waits to set you free.
Perhaps no path can break across your sea
Until the stinging east-wind rise and blow.
Perhaps for forty years your soul must grow
Before you glimpse the fire on bush or tree.
Alone within a cave your fate may be
That out of silence God's own voice may flow.

Be sure that God will answer honest prayer --
Not always as we hoped or planned the way.
Have patience then to wait His promised hour.
For He who marks the sparrow's fall out there
Will hear the child who lifts his heart to pray.
When time is ripe He will reveal His power.
